Output 6d512d42efb2f32d745f9fc2c3e50259b55a64a0c20b55df94a3a43ae7cbbfeb:3

value
4571347137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d87b9817db18234071776a5728215b637be31bf8 OP_EQUAL
address
3MRfwSyjDqX5kWGfTXwb5ri8Ui15vsb5wU
transaction
6d512d42efb2f32d745f9fc2c3e50259b55a64a0c20b55df94a3a43ae7cbbfeb
confirmations
431298
spent
true